    What a highly informative and practical review! One commentator appears surprised that Jaguar has ceased to be a “car for old men”. In fact, the brand always had a diverse audience. Sir William Lyons - its founder - realised to be profitable this was vital. In the 1950s and 1960s the XK 120s, 140s,150s, and originally the E Types were largely younger peoples’ cars. The current management has happily realised that. The success of the F type says it all. I look forward to more reviews from Oliur. Thanks for posting.

  • @patoubel
    @patoubel 5 ปีที่แล้ว +4

    Good review . I have the exact same car. I have 55000km on the odometer and only had one issue with the active exhaust system (broken, under warranty.). I love the car but like you said, the infotainment system is horendous. Little disappointment too with the sound system. Not as good as my B&O in my Audi S4. Sports seat are very comfortable, even for long runs. Also, It took me 2 years to find a good driving position, where I could see my speed and RPM. Cabin space in sparse...can't even find a place to put a bottle of water (door pocket too small).
